Title of article :
Fatigue crack initiation behavior in embrittled austenitic–ferritic stainless steel

Abstract :
Fatigue crack initiation behavior in duplex stainless steel was studied in the embrittled condition (aging at 475 °C for 100 h) by interrupting fatigue tests conducted at different Δσ/2 values, identifying the crack initiation sites and relating them to the crystallographic parameters obtained from electron back scattered diffraction scans. From the fatigue crack initiation studies conducted at Δσ/2 = 400 and 500 MPa, it was concluded that the crack initiation sites are the slip markings corresponding to {1 1 1} plane in austenite at 400 MPa and more cracks were observed to initiate at twin boundaries in austenite at 500 MPa in the aged condition.
